服务器管理员

系统和网络管理员的问答

5
从命令行回收远程IIS应用程序池?
此问题是从超级用户迁移的,因为可以在服务器故障时回答。 迁移 8年前。 是否可以从命令行在另一台计算机上回收IIS7应用程序池? 我找到了APPCMD(appcmd recycle apppool my-app-pool),但它只能在运行它的主机AFAICT上运行。 我听说有一个谣言可能使用Powershell来实现,但是对此我一无所知,而且我显然不太擅长使用它。 如果有的话,我正在使用Vista / Server 2008。 编辑:我发现有人称WinRM本身可以运行APPCMD,但我不确定具体如何。

5
我可以将(大)地址块绑定到接口吗?
我知道ip工具可让您将多个地址绑定到一个接口(例如,http : //www.linuxplanet.com/linuxplanet/tutorials/6553/1/)。不过,现在,我正在尝试在IPv6之上构建一些东西,并且拥有整个可用地址块(例如/ 64)将非常有用,以便程序可以从范围和地址中选择任何地址。绑定到那个。不用说,将这个范围内的每个IP附加到接口上都需要一段时间。 Linux是否支持将整个地址块绑定到接口?
26 linux  ipv6 


9
Daemontools(djbtools)的替代品可以监督Unix进程?
我使用Daemontools提供了一种简单可靠的方法来监督服务器上的Unix服务。它运作良好,但是需要一种不同的思维方式(DJB方式),并且一些常见的抱怨是: 基于TAI64N的时间戳 不在/etc/init.d(或(/usr/local)/etc/rc.d)下存储脚本 并非总是与apachectl之类的脚本一起使用。一些脚本需要重写。 我记得大约两年前有一些类似的“主管/看门狗”守护程序在工作,但有些仍然有些粗糙。 如果您已从Daemontools切换到其他功能,那么您选择了什么并且对您来说效果很好?RedHat或Ubuntu默认情况下是否带有任何流程管理器实用程序?
26 unix  daemontools 

8
适用于Linux的安全网络文件系统:人们在做什么?
NFSv3已经广泛使用,但是默认的安全模型是... quaint。CIFS可以使用Kerberos身份验证,但是如果没有POSIX语义,它就不是启动器。AFS从来没有对网络上的流量进行加密,它是krb4-基本上是一个无效的项目。新奇的实验性文件系统从未实现过,或者专注于速度(如果幸运的话,数据可靠性)—例如,Lustre使用与NFSv3相同的客户端信任模型。对于家庭使用,sshfs很漂亮,但是肯定不能扩展。 然后当然是NFSv4,其sec = krb5p。从理论上讲很棒,但是十年后,它似乎在现实世界中令人难以使用。Linux客户端刚刚删除了实验标签。如果您看一下EMC Celerra,Isilon等,它们全都是NFSv3。(Celerra支持NFSv4,但是它确实被埋藏在文档中。Isilon显然致力于将RPCGSS支持添加到FreeBSD中,所以也许它即将推出,但是现在不存在。)我什至不能将此帖子标记为“ nfsv4”,因为我这里是新的,那将是一个新标签。 所以,真的。你们都在做什么

9
删除所有的/ var / log吗?
我可以删除其中的所有内容/var/log吗?还是应该只(递归地)删除文件/var/log夹中的文件而保留文件夹? 有人有一个好的rm命令行吗?(我的管理技能使我感到紧张。) 注意:我正在使用Debian。我不确定是哪个版本。
26 linux  logging 

3
替代Apache基准测试?[关闭]
关闭。这个问题是题外话。它当前不接受答案。 想改善这个问题吗? 更新问题,使它成为服务器故障的主题。 4年前关闭。 我想要一些用于ubuntu的工具,可以用来测试服务器,可以处理多少服务器。 有什么建议么?我以前使用过Apache基准测试,但我想尝试其他方法。 (作为一个附带的问题,如果仅使用nginx,apache基准测试是否有效?)

3
subdomain.example.com可以设置example.com可以读取的Cookie吗?
已锁定。该问题及其答案被锁定,因为该问题是题外话,但具有历史意义。它目前不接受新的答案或互动。 我简直不敢相信这很难确定。 即使已经阅读了RFC,但我仍然不清楚subdomain.example.com上的服务器是否可以设置example.com可以读取的cookie。 subdomain.example.com可以设置Domain属性为.example.com的cookie。RFC 2965似乎明确声明不会将此类cookie发送到example.com,但是同样表示,如果您设置Domain = example.com,则会在前面加上一个点,就好像您说的是.example.com。综上所述,这似乎是说,如果exam​​ple.com返回设置了Domain = example.com的cookie,那么它不会收回该cookie!那是不对的。 谁能澄清规则的真正含义?



8
Linux:计划命令在重新引导后运行一次(等效于RunOnce)
我想安排在Linux机器上重新启动后运行的命令。我知道如何执行此操作,以便在每次重新启动后使用@rebootcrontab条目始终运行该命令,但是我只希望该命令运行一次。它运行后,应从要运行的命令队列中删除。我实质上是在Windows世界中寻找与RunOnce等效的Linux 。 如果很重要: $ uname -a Linux devbox 2.6.27.19-5-default #1 SMP 2009-02-28 04:40:21 +0100 x86_64 x86_64 x86_64 GNU/Linux $ bash --version GNU bash, version 3.2.48(1)-release (x86_64-suse-linux-gnu) Copyright (C) 2007 Free Software Foundation, Inc. $ cat /etc/SuSE-release SUSE Linux Enterprise Server 11 (x86_64) VERSION = 11 PATCHLEVEL = 0 有没有简单,可编写脚本的方式来执行此操作?


13
使用%time%变量,批处理脚本需要前导零
已锁定。该问题及其答案被锁定,因为该问题是题外话,但具有历史意义。它目前不接受新的答案或互动。 我在DOS脚本中遇到了一个错误,该错误使用日期和时间数据进行文件命名。问题是我最终以间隔结束,因为时间变量没有在小时<10时自动提供前导零。所以运行> echo%time%会返回:'9:29:17.88'。 有谁知道有条件地填充前导零以解决此问题的方法吗? 更多信息:我的文件名设置命令是: set logfile=C:\Temp\robolog_%date:~-4%%date:~4,2%%date:~7,2%_%time:~0,2%%time:~3,2%%time:~6,2%.log 最终是:C:\ Temp \ robolog_20100602_ 93208.log(上午9:23)。 这个问题与此有关。 谢谢


6
我的Tomcat日志在哪里?
我使用apt-get install tomcat6在Ubuntu 9.04服务器上安装了Tomcat6。我使用管理器界面上传了一个WAR,并尝试启动该应用程序,但是在Web界面上收到一个非常普通的错误,提示它无法启动。 我试图查找日志以确定为什么我的战争将不会开始(我怀疑内存不足,因为我使用的是小型VPS),但我不知道它们在哪里。 / var / lib / tomcat6 / logs为空。我的Tomcat启动页面可靠地通知我以下情况: Tomcat is installed with CATALINA_HOME in /usr/share/tomcat6 CATALINA_BASE in /var/lib/tomcat6, following the rules from /usr/share/doc/tomcat6-common/RUNNING.txt.gz. 更新 我试过跑步; $ ps -ax /usr/bin/jsvc -user tomcat6 -cp /usr/share/java/commons-daemon.jar:/usr/share/tomcat6/bin/bootstrap.jar -outfile SYSLOG -errfile SYSLOG -pidfile /var/run/tomcat6.pid 但是/ var / log / syslog中没有任何内容 …

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.